Local Impact and Current Conditions

Tropical Storm Edouard is tracking toward the Texas-Louisiana border, bringing a shift in local weather patterns for Princeton. While the heaviest rainfall is expected to remain over Southeast Texas, the system is forecast to turn west-northwest and weaken as it approaches Central Texas. This movement is expected to break the recent run of 100-degree days, offering a slight relief from the intense heat.

Currently, the air temperature is 90 degrees Fahrenheit, with a feels-like temperature of 95 degrees. Relative humidity stands at 52 percent, and the dew point is 70 degrees. Winds are light at 6 mph, with gusts to 4 mph, and the sky is clear.

Today's Forecast and Air Quality

Residents should expect a high near 100 degrees today, with temperatures falling to around 98 in the afternoon. The heat index values may reach as high as 102 degrees. There is a slight chance of rain showers between 1 pm and 4 pm, followed by a slight chance of showers and thunderstorms.

The overall chance of precipitation is 12 percent. Southeast winds will blow at 5 to 10 mph. An Air Quality Alert has been issued by the National Weather Service for the Fort Worth area.

While the alert's specific severity and urgency are not detailed in the current data, residents are advised to stay informed about air quality conditions.

Overnight and Tomorrow Outlook

Tonight, the sky will remain mostly clear with a low around 77 degrees. Temperatures may rise to around 79 degrees overnight, with heat index values again reaching 102 degrees. A slight chance of showers and thunderstorms persists.

Tomorrow, the high will be near 98 degrees, with a low around 75 degrees. The chance of precipitation rises to 22 percent, with a slight chance of rain showers before 7 am and a slight chance of showers and thunderstorms later. East southeast winds will be 5 to 10 mph, with gusts as high as 20 mph.

The heat index could reach 104 degrees. As the storm system moves through, the overall trend is toward easing heat and modest rain chances, with the most significant impacts remaining south and east of Princeton.
